Avoid looking for debug library unless configuring for MSVC. Before this change the variable PROTOBUF_LIBRARIES under unix was 'optimized;/usr/lib/libprotobuf.so;debug;/usr/lib/libprotobuf.so' --- Modules/FindProtobuf.cmake | 10 ++++++---- 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
